WebProkaryotic cells comprise bacteria and archaea. Their genetic material isn’t stored within a membrane-bound nucleus. Instead, it is stored in a nucleoid that floats in the cell’s cytoplasm. WebThe bacterial chromosome consists of about 50 giant supercoiled loops of DNA. Although the nucleoid seems randomly generated, the chromosome is, in fact, highly organized. The location of a gene on the circle correlates with a specific location within a nucleoid region.
